Contenido IHR Providers: Canadian court upholds termination of unvaccinated worker: Sagardoy (IUS Laboris)
The Ontario Court of Appeal recently held that an employee’s failure to meet COVID-19 vaccination requirements imposed by a third party amounted to frustration of the employment contract. Accede al CONTENIDO completo Fuente: Sagardoy Abogados

Contenido IHR Providers: Belgium: Employment protections extended to infertility treatment: Sagardoy (IUS Laboris)
A recent legislative amendment in Belgium introduces protection against dismissal and a prohibition of discrimination when an employee is absent due to an infertility treatment or a programme of medically assisted reproduction. Accede al CONTENIDO completo Fuente: Sagardoy Abogados
